What Are Car Title Loans and How Do They Work? Car title loans are secured loans that allow borrowers to use their vehicle's title as collateral. This means that individuals can obtain cash by pledging their car title, typically for a short-term period. The loan amount is usually based on the vehicle's value, and borrowers retain possession of their vehicles during the loan term.

Navigating Risks: What Borrowers Should Know While car title loans can provide quick access to cash, they are not without risks. One significant concern is the potential for high-interest rates, which can lead to a cycle of debt if borrowers are unable to repay the loan on time. Some individuals find themselves taking out new loans to pay off existing ones, leading to a situation where they pay more in interest than the original loan amount.

If you are unable to repay your car title loan, the lender may repossess your vehicle to recover the amount owed. This can lead to significant financial and transportation issues, which is why it's crucial to assess your repayment ability before borrowing.

Additionally, borrowers may inadvertently trap themselves in a cycle of debt. If unable to repay on time, they might resort to taking out new loans to cover the original loan, leading to compounding debt.
